Arts, Theater & Music Camps

🎨 Unleash Creativity with Visual & Performing Arts Camps

Let your child explore their artistic side! San Diego summer camps focused on visual and performing arts offer hands-on fun with painting, ceramics, improv, acting, and music. These programs help build confidence, encourage speaking skills, and teach new talents in a positive setting.

Campers might stage a play, learn stage makeup, create stop-motion videos, or try new instruments. Many camps even host end-of-session shows for families.

Gymnastics, Ninja and Martial Arts Camps

🤸 Active & Adventure Camps

If your child loves action, check out San Diego’s gymnastics, martial arts, and ninja camps. These programs focus on strength, agility, and discipline through exciting obstacle courses and challenges.

Kids learn tumbling, self-defense, coordination, and focus in a supportive setting led by skilled coaches. These camps are especially great for younger children and energetic learners.

Traditional Camps

🏕️ Traditional Day Camps

Traditional day camps provide a mix of indoor and outdoor fun, often held at local parks, rec centers, and schools. They’re perfect for elementary-aged kids who want a summer full of variety.

Activities include nature walks, games, crafts, science projects, and themed days. These San Diego summer camps help kids try new things and make friends in a safe, structured place. They’re also ideal for parents who need full-day or half-day care.

Overnight Camp

⛺ Overnight & Sleepaway Camps

Ready for a bigger adventure? Sleepaway camps let kids build independence while trying activities like kayaking, archery, rock climbing, and campfires. Many of these camps are located in the beautiful backcountry or mountains near San Diego County.

With stays from three nights to several weeks, overnight camps create lasting memories and support social growth. Your child will unplug, enjoy nature, and come home with new skills and friends.

Academic, STEM & Technology Camps

🔬 Academic & STEM Camps

Inspire curiosity with hands-on STEM camps! San Diego offers programs in robotics, game design, animation, marine biology, and environmental science. These camps make learning fun and age-appropriate.

Your child might build a robot, code a game, learn from zoo experts, or try VR design. Many STEM camps are taught by pros from universities, labs, or tech companies, giving kids a peek into real-world careers.

These are some of the most popular San Diego summer camps for middle schoolers and teens who want to boost their tech skills while having a great time.

Animals, Nature & Outdoor Camps

🌿 Outdoor & Nature Camps

Perfect for kids who love the outdoors! Nature camps explore animal care, farming, hiking, gardening, and wildlife education through hands-on activities.

Campers may feed farm animals, track wildlife, or learn about ocean life at places like Birch Aquarium or Balboa Park. These programs teach respect for nature and encourage unplugged fun outside.

Sports Camps: Indoors, Outdoors & Water-sports

⚽ Sports Camps

Got an active kid? San Diego sports camps are perfect for burning energy and building teamwork. Choose from classics like soccer, basketball, and baseball, or try something new like surfing, paddleboarding, or ninja training.

These camps help kids improve skills, gain confidence, and learn good sportsmanship—all while having fun. Many programs use San Diego’s great weather and beaches for water-based activities.

Tips for Choosing a Last-Minute Summer Camp

⏳ Last-Minute Camp Tips

Did summer sneak up on you? Don’t worry, many camps offer rolling sign-ups, sibling discounts, or flexible sessions.

Your first step is to check availability at smaller, local programs and be open to new experiences. After that, make a list of your child’s interests, your preferred location, and any special needs. Above all, always prioritize safety, staff experience, and the camp’s daily structure. And remember, don’t hesitate to contact camps directly, you might be surprised by what’s still available!
